Hybrid solar cells based on ZnO nanorod arrays/ polymer — •Basudev Pradhan and Dieter Neher — Institut für Physik und Astronomie, Universität Potsdam, Potsdam-Golm, Germany

Hybrid solar cells have been fabricated using vertically oriented, high density, and crystalline array of zinc oxide (ZnO) nanorods and low bandgap hole conducting polymer. These hybrid solar cells take advantage of the both materials properties: solution processing of polymers and high electron mobility of inorganic semiconductors. The vertical nanorods provide direct conduction paths for the electrons from the point of injection to the collection electrode while maintaining large interface area between polymer and nanorod arrays. We have found that the device performance improves with deep infiltration of the polymer into the nanorod arrays and also with the improved crystallinity of the polymer induced by post annealing. In addition, the dependence of photovoltaic performance on the ZnO nanorod length was investigated and different low bandgap polymers have been used to achieve optimum performance.
